"er" meaning in Cornish

See er in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: [eːɹ] Forms: eryon [plural], eres [plural]
Etymology: From Old Cornish er, from Proto-Celtic *eriros (“eagle”) (compare Breton erer, Welsh eryr, Old Irish *irar), from Proto-Indo-European *h₃érō (“large bird”).
